Mélanie Joly was born on January 16, 1979, in Laval, Quebec. Throughout her life, she has demonstrated a commitment to public service and a deep understanding of the complexities of governance. Her journey into politics began with her involvement in community activism, where she quickly became known for her passion and dedication. Over the years, she has held various roles, including Minister of Canadian Heritage, and has been a key player in the Liberal Party of Canada.
